WebbIAN THOMPSON is Reader in Landscape Architecture at the School of Architecture, Planning and Landscape at Newcastle University, England, where he has taught for 28 years. His PhD research into value systems in landscape architecture practice became the book Ecology, Community and Delight (1999) which won a Landscape Institute award. WebbRM 2M6KN68 – Officer Ian Thompson, City of Dover Police Department lead motorcycle patrolman training, speaks at the 2024 Motorcycle Safety Day briefing held at The Landings on Dover Air Force Base, Delaware, April 29, 2024. Thompson spoke to attendees about why DPD motorcycle patrolman train on their riding skills. WebbI Lindisfarne sono un gruppo folk rock britannico molto popolare negli anni settanta [1]. La formazione storica era capitanata da Alan Hull (20 febbraio 1945 - 17 novembre 1995 ), voce, chitarra e piano del gruppo [2].
